Marijuana Facility Automation

Full range of engineering, design, and development services for
commercial cannabis cultivation and processing facilities.

What are your needs?



Grow Room Automation

DMC can develop a new automated system
or make modifications to add functionality.

We can make improvements to your process and
keep your facility running at maximum efficiency
without overhauling your entire operation.

Growth & Energy Optimization

Run an efficient facility with maximum output
to simply get more for less.

Grow healthier plants with higher yield per square foot
and reduced costs using energy management.

Safety and Compliance

Safer operations and legal compliance
for THC extraction facilities.

DMC will help get your facility compliant
with Class 1 Div 1 safety requirements.

Areas of Expertise

  • Energy management systems
  • Data collection and reporting
  • Light automation
  • Remote monitoring
  • Watering systems
  • Greenhouse and humidity control
  • Quality control
  • Hazloc conditions

Tell us about your next project

Contact us

Our Work

Why work with DMC?

Successfully completed thousands
of projects for customers around the
world over the past twenty years.
120+ Employees
We are responsive, flexible, and often
available to take large projects on –
even with short notice.

DMC has an exceptionally wide range of deep expertise and certifications in many technologies and platforms, making us a one-stop shop for engineering solutions. We have expert engineers in areas including manufacturing automation, test and measurement systems, and custom hardware and software development.

We are certified by the Control Systems Integrator Association (CSIA) for excellent business practices.

Lastly, we believe customers should work with us because they want to, not because they have to. To that end, we build flexible systems, deliver full source code, and train your staff on system modification procedures.

Get started on your project!

Contact us

"We came to DMC with an idea. The wide range of engineering services they offer made it ideal for a new company, developing a new product, and also for us to grow with. To be direct, it is their expertise that brought us to DMC, but it is the people that make us want to stay."
- Eli Lazar, Co-Founder

DMC can help automate and regulate
any step of your process:

  • Cutting
  • Fertilization
  • Watering
  • Drying
  • Bud removal, trimming, and shaping
  • THC extraction
  • Controlled storage
  • Weighing and packaging

Related Expertise

PLC Programming

PLCs can be used to control grow room automation, including automatic watering, humidity control and more. PLC programming is one of DMC's specialties.

Learn More

Machine Vision Inspection

Machine vision inspection is used for many processing operations,
including laser bud cutting, label inspection, quality control,
robotic guidance and more.

Learn More


DMC's in-house designer helps create advanced, intuitive HMIs for controlling your system. We can also implement a SCADA system for features like data collection and reporting, machine maintenance, and more.

Learn More

Wherever your team is at in the process,
DMC can help.